Schematic Diagramming
Schematic diagrams clarify complex systems. They map connections and flows by stripping away unnecessary details. Think of it as a blueprint. This exercise works well for technical concepts, user flows, or system architecture.

Aim for simplicity. Use standard symbols where possible. Label everything clearly. Always test for understanding by asking participants to explain the diagram back to you. Sometimes, despite best efforts, participants struggle with abstracting the system, so be ready to offer concrete examples.
